音声識別(Speaker Identification)とは何ですか?

IT初心者
音声識別って何ですか?どんな仕組みで働いているのですか?

IT専門家
音声識別は、特定の話者の声を認識する技術です。主に声の特徴を分析し、データベースに登録された声と照合することで、その話者を特定します。

IT初心者
具体的にはどうやって声を分析するんですか?

IT専門家
音声データをまずデジタル信号に変換し、その後、音の周波数や音色、持続時間などの特徴量を抽出します。これにより、各話者のユニークな声のパターンを特定できます。
音声識別(Speaker Identification)の基本概念
音声識別(Speaker Identification)は、話者の声を認識し、特定する技術です。この技術は、様々なアプリケーションで利用されており、セキュリティシステム、電話認証、カスタマーサポートなどで重要な役割を果たしています。音声識別は、音声をデジタル信号に変換し、特定の特徴を抽出することから始まります。これらの特徴は、各話者の声のユニークなパターンを形成し、データベースに登録された他の声と照合されます。
音声識別の仕組み
音声識別のプロセスは以下のステップで進行します。
1. 音声の収集
まず、マイクロフォンなどのデバイスを使用して音声を収集します。収集された音声は、アナログ信号からデジタル信号に変換される必要があります。この変換は、音声データをコンピュータが処理できる形式にするために重要です。
2. 特徴抽出
次に、音声データから特徴を抽出します。ここでは、音の周波数、音色、音の持続時間、音の強さなどの情報が解析されます。これらの特徴は、各話者の声の「指紋」のような役割を果たし、それぞれの声の特性を表現します。
3. モデルの構築
抽出された特徴は、機械学習アルゴリズムを使用してモデルに組み込まれます。このモデルは、様々な話者の声のデータを学習し、特定の話者を識別するための基盤を提供します。一般的には、サポートベクターマシン(SVM)やディープラーニング技術などが用いられます。
4. 照合と認識
最後に、識別したい音声を使って、データベースに登録された声と照合します。照合の結果、最も一致する声が特定され、話者が認識されます。これにより、音声識別システムは、特定の話者を正確に認識できるようになります。
音声識別の応用
音声識別技術は、様々な分野で広く活用されています。以下にいくつかの代表的な応用例を紹介します。
1. セキュリティシステム
音声識別は、バイオメトリクスの一種として、セキュリティシステムに利用されています。例えば、電話での認証や、スマートフォンのロック解除に使われています。特定の話者の声だけが認識されるため、セキュリティが向上します。
2. カスタマーサポート
カスタマーサポートでは、顧客の声を識別することで、迅速な対応が可能になります。顧客の声を認識することで、過去のやり取りや好みを把握し、より個別化されたサービスを提供できます。
3. 音声アシスタント
音声アシスタント(例:スマートスピーカーやスマートフォンの音声機能)でも、音声識別技術が利用されています。個々のユーザーの声を認識することで、各ユーザーに対してパーソナライズされた応答を返すことができます。
音声識別の課題と未来
音声識別技術にはいくつかの課題があります。例えば、雑音環境での正確な認識や、異なるアクセントや話し方に対する対応が挙げられます。これらの課題を克服するために、さらなる研究と技術の進歩が期待されています。
将来的には、音声識別技術はより高精度に進化し、様々な分野での応用が広がるでしょう。特に、AI技術の進展により、音声識別の精度と速度が向上し、より多くの人々の日常生活で利用されるようになると考えられています。
音声識別は、単なる技術ではなく、私たちの生活を便利にするための重要な要素となっています。今後もその進化に注目が集まることでしょう。

